In the wake of a tragic incident in Kočani, North Macedonia, the International Federation of Journalists (IFJ) has issued a call for media outlets to adhere to the highest standards of journalistic ethics while covering the event. As details continue to emerge, the IFJ emphasizes the critical role of responsible reporting in ensuring that the dignity of victims and their families is upheld. This necessitates a delicate balance between the public’s right to know and the ethical obligation to avoid sensationalism. Media Responsibility in Reporting the Kočani Tragedy
The recent tragedy in Kočani has sparked notable media attention,highlighting the urgent need for responsible reporting practices. Journalists are tasked not only with disseminating details but also with ensuring that their coverage honors the dignity of victims and their families. Ethical journalism should aim to provide accurate accounts without sensationalism, thereby fostering an informed public discourse. media outlets must adhere to essential principles, which include:
- accuracy: Ensuring all facts are verified and presented truthfully.
- Respect for Privacy: Avoiding intrusion into the personal grief of victims’ families.
- Contextual Reporting: Providing background information that helps the audience understand the full picture.
- Sensitivity: Being mindful of the emotional impact that coverage may have on affected communities.

Upholding Ethical Standards in News Coverage
The recent tragedy in Kočani has raised significant concerns regarding the ethical responsibilities of media outlets in their reporting. It is imperative that journalists adhere to the core principles of responsible journalism when covering such sensitive incidents. The tragic nature of the event demands that coverage is not only factual but also considerate of the emotional toll on victims’ families and the community. Ethical reporting should prioritize accuracy, sensitivity, and context to avoid sensationalism that can further distress those affected.
journalists should take into account a set of guidelines to maintain high ethical standards. These include:
- Respect for Privacy: Protecting the identities and personal details of victims and their families.
- Fact-Checking: Ensuring that all information presented is verified and cannot contribute to public misinformation.
- Balanced Perspectives: Providing a platform for diverse voices, particularly those directly impacted by the tragedy.
- Avoiding Speculation: Reporting should refrain from conjecture about causes or motivations unless confirmed by credible sources.
